EDITORS COMMENTS
This photograph, titled "Travel views of Europe, 1900s. Grand-Place, Brussels," is a stunning representation of the Grand Place in Brussels, Belgium, captured by the skilled lens of American photographer Arnold Genthe in the early 20th century. The image transports us back in time, offering a glimpse into the architectural grandeur and vibrant energy of Europe during an era of burgeoning tourism. The Grand Place, also known as the Grote Markt, is a UNESCO World Heritage site and the central square of Brussels. The photograph showcases the intricate gothic architecture of the town hall, adorned with ornate gables and intricate stonework, standing proudly at the heart of the square. The square is bustling with activity, as people go about their daily routines, adding a sense of life and energy to the scene. Arnold Genthe, an American photographer, captured this image using a nitrate negative, a common photographic process of the time. The resulting monochromatic image showcases the rich textures and details of the buildings, while the contrast between the light and dark areas adds depth and dimension to the image. This photograph is part of the Arnold Genthe Collection, housed at the Library of Congress in the United States.
